Zermatt

Description Pictures Facts
France has the Eiffel Tower, Italy the leaning tower of Pisa - and Switzerland...? The Matterhorn! At its foot lies the exclusive and traditional winter sports resort of Zermatt, where modern mountain transport systems, cosy hotels and holiday apartments, and friendly hosts await you. Zermatt is the ideal holiday destination for sports enthusiasts and for those simply looking for rest and relaxation.
Italy or Switzerland? That is the question! 62 mountain trains, cableways and lifts link the 313 km of pistes of Cervinia and Zermatt. 2 children's ski clubs introduce the very young to the world of skiing, while challenging freerider slopes, heliskiing and the Gravity Park bring joy to the wildest of winter sports fans. Do you fancy covering 12,500 m of height difference in one day without ever using the same piste, lift or cableway twice? Then the Matterhorn Ski Safari is just the thing for you - an ambitious tour for everyone fit enough to give it a go!
Spend a night in the snow in an igloo village! Choose from a romantic suite for two or a group igloo for up to 6 people and dive into the tradition of the Inuit.
As insiders have known for a long time now, nowhere has better ski huts than Zermatt! Come up and try our great food in a relaxed and cosy setting.
Unique in Switzerland - children ski free of charge up to the age of 9, and half price up to the age of 16. The ski schools provide childcare for the whole day with the children’s park and the kindergarten (indoor) from 9 am through to 3.30 pm, making skiing and playing in the snow doubly fun. Zermatt is the perfect place for unforgettable family holidays!

Located 250 km from Zurich and 230 km from Geneva, Zermatt can be approached by car and by public transportation. Please keep in mind that Zermatt is a car-free resort. Access for private transport is only allowed as far as Täsch (5 km from Zermatt). The road from Täsch to Zermatt is not open to public transport. If you wish to come by car taking the expressway from Zurich to Täsch via Bern will take about 3 hours 50 minutes. Coming from Geneva, you should arrive in Täsch, via Lausanne, after about 3 hours 15 minutes.
